Wine tasting is usually regarded as an art kind, one that goes past merely having fun with a beverage. It embraces a complex interaction of flavors, aromas, and textures that requires dedicated practice to really master. Many who venture into the world of wine tasting rapidly understand that it entails far more than simply sipping wine. Enhancing sensory skills by way of dedicated winery wine tasting can elevate the experience, remodeling a casual consuming occasion into a classy exploration of the senses.
At a fundamental level, wine tasting engages the senses of sight, odor, taste, touch, and even sound. Every component performs a vital role in appreciating the nuances of a wine. When one first pours a glass of wine, the wealthy hues can present initial insights into its age and varietal. Observing the color and clarity helps form expectations in regards to the wine's flavor profile. Many don’t fully recognize how this visual evaluation can set the stage for what is to comply with.
The next step is to interact the sense of scent. Swirling the glass aerates the wine, allowing its risky compounds to flee and fill the air with its bouquet. The nostril entails some fascinating layers—different aromas can signal numerous elements of the winemaking course of, together with the type of grapes used, fermentation methods, and growing older situations. Growing a keen sense of smell is often a game-changer in wine tasting.

To improve this sensory skill, wine enthusiasts are often inspired to participate in devoted tastings at wineries. These tastings allow people to focus solely on the sensory experience (Wineries Ideal For Large Groups). Tasting periods led by educated sommeliers or winemakers can supply insights into figuring out distinct aromas. Learning to distinguish between floral, fruity, earthy, and spicy notes can empower a taster to articulate their experience with larger precision.
As one practices their sensory skills, they could uncover that their taste preferences evolve. This transformation often happens after multiple tastings. A wine that initially seemed overwhelming would possibly reveal hidden layers of complexity with a bit of experience. Understanding how to isolate particular person flavors similar to acidity, sweetness, bitterness, and umami contributes considerably to the overall wine experience.
One Other important element in bettering sensory skills is the context in which wine is tasted. Environmental elements like temperature, lighting, and even the corporate present can affect perceptions. At a winery, an optimal setting can scale back distractions and allow a more profound exploration of the wine (Spectacular Vineyard Views In Sonoma). Working Towards mindful tasting techniques encourages a extra immersive experience, permitting tasters to hone in on their senses.
It isn't solely about individual notion, though. Engaging with others during a tasting can also improve sensory skills. Sharing notes and discussing impressions fosters a deeper understanding of the wine. This collaborative approach encourages participants to articulate their sensory experiences, thereby broadening their linguistic repertoire associated to wine tasting.

Moreover, pairing wine with food can significantly enhance the tasting experience. Completely Different mixtures can bring out unique flavors in each the wine and the dish. As one tastes a wine alongside specific foods, they'll start to recognize how sure parts in the wine complement or distinction with what they are eating. This skill of pairing is one other layer that enriches sensory improvement.
Coaching one’s palate can contain a variety of workouts. Some enthusiasts have interaction in systematic tasting experiences, sampling a variety of wines that showcase different varietals, areas, or vintages. Exploring this variety can sharpen the power to discern nuances across completely different wine profiles. Over time, this practice builds a psychological library of flavors that might be accessed throughout future tastings.
Notably, written notes serve a dual purpose: organizing one’s thoughts and reinforcing memory. see this By writing down observations about every wine, tasters can track their progress over time. Detailing the traits of wines assists in solidifying knowledge, finally deepening one’s appreciation of what they consume.
Moreover, attending workshops or classes targeted on sensory evaluation may additionally be beneficial. Many wineries provide these educational packages to assist individuals refine their skills. Typically, skilled instructors guide members by way of structured tastings, specializing in specific elements of the wine. This degree of training reinforces the sensory skills asynchronously and challenges tasters to assume about their experiences from different angles.
